构建您自己的本地 AI 代理(第 4 部分):PII 清洗器 🧼

发布: (2026年1月8日 GMT+8 21:00)
2 分钟阅读
原文: Dev.to

Source: Dev.to

概述

欢迎来到我们本地代理系列的终章。处理敏感用户数据(PII)风险很大——你不能把它发送到云端,也不想手动阅读。PII Scrubber Agent 展示了“Level 2”代理能力:编写自己的工具

目标

  • 分析一个 CSV(users.csv)。
  • 检测 PII(电子邮件、姓名)。
  • 编写 Python 脚本 安全地清理数据。
  • 运行脚本 生成 users_cleaned.csv

架构:计划、编码、运行

与其逐行重写 CSV(慢且昂贵),代理会编写代码以高效完成此任务。

The Architecture

“智能” 要求

较小的模型(例如 llama3.2)会崩溃,因为它们在编写脚本之前就尝试运行它。升级到 gpt-oss:20b 解决了此问题:

  1. 暂停以检查文件。
  2. 编写完整的 Python 脚本。
  3. 成功执行它。

Output of PII Scrubber

结论

我们已经构建了四个代理:

  • Tidy‑Up – 简单操作。
  • Analyst – 数据库查询。
  • Archaeologist – 文件编辑。
  • Scrubber – 代码生成与执行。

所有这些都是 本地 构建的——没有 API 密钥,没有数据泄漏。只有你、Goose 和 Ollama。

完整代码可在 GitHub 这里 获取。

去构建一些酷炫的东西吧! 🪿

Back to Blog

相关文章

阅读更多 »

你好,我是新人。

嗨!我又回到 STEM 的领域了。我也喜欢学习能源系统、科学、技术、工程和数学。其中一个项目是…